Continuously Wound Spiral Laser Welded Form Finned Tubes

The fin profile is joined to the tube surface by high-precision laser welding, creating a metallurgical bond for maximum heat transfer.

In our laser welded finned tube production, the fin profile is joined to the tube surface continuously and homogeneously using high-precision laser welding technology. This method creates a metallurgical bond between the fin and the tube, achieving maximum heat transfer.

Because the laser welding process produces minimal heat input in the weld zone, it prevents distortion of the tube and fin geometry. This provides high dimensional accuracy, a smooth surface finish and a long service life.

Laser welded finned tubes are preferred particularly in applications involving high temperature, high pressure and demanding operating conditions. Production is possible with carbon steel, stainless steel and alloy steel tube and fin options. Surface coating and corrosion-protection treatments can also be applied on request.

Advantages and Disadvantages

  • Production cost is higher than the corrugated, L and KL form finned tubes; in return, the metallurgical bond achieved between fin and tube by laser welding gives very high heat transfer.
  • Thanks to the continuous and homogeneous weld structure, it offers a long service life in systems exposed to high temperature and continuous thermal cycling.
  • Because the fin-to-tube joint is welded rather than mechanical, resistance to tube vibration caused by high-velocity air flow is increased.
  • As there is no gap between fin and tube, contact resistance is minimal, which delivers high efficiency.
  • The smooth surface structure keeps turbulence low, so air-borne noise is very low.
  • It has a low tendency to trap dust, dirt and similar particles, which is an advantage for maintenance and cleaning.
  • Because of the welded structure, repair options are limited in the event of damage and part replacement is generally required.
